来源:小编 更新:2025-02-07 07:16:55
用手机看
你有没有想过,你的手机里那个神奇的安卓系统,它到底是怎么运作的呢?就像一个庞大的乐高积木,每一块都紧密相连,缺一不可。今天,就让我带你一起揭开安卓系统构架的神秘面纱,看看它是怎么填写的吧!
安卓系统构架就像一场精彩的交响乐,由四层不同的“乐器”组成,它们分别是:
1. 应用层:这是最接近用户的一层,就像乐队的指挥家,指挥着整个乐队。这一层包括了各种应用程序,比如微信、支付宝、浏览器等,它们都是用Java语言编写的,方便用户直接使用。
2. 应用框架层:这一层就像是乐队的指挥,它负责协调各个应用程序之间的工作。在这一层,你可以看到丰富的API框架,比如视图(Views)、内容提供器(ContentProviders)、资源管理器(ResourceManager)等,它们让应用程序之间的交互变得简单高效。
3. 系统运行库层:这一层就像是乐队的乐器,为整个乐队提供支持。它包括了Android运行时(ART)和核心库,ART负责运行应用程序,而核心库则提供了各种基础功能,比如图形处理、网络通信等。
4. Linux内核层:这是最底层的一层,就像是乐队的音响设备,为整个乐队提供稳定的音效。Linux内核负责管理硬件资源,提供安全性和稳定性,确保整个系统的正常运行。
除了四层结构,安卓系统构架还可以用“五部曲”来描述:
1. Linux内核:这是整个系统的基石,负责硬件管理和系统资源分配。
2. Android运行时:包括ART(Android运行时)和核心库,负责应用程序的运行和资源管理。
3. 应用程序框架:提供丰富的API和组件,方便开发者开发应用程序。
4. 应用程序:用户可以直接使用的应用程序,如微信、支付宝等。
5. 系统工具和服务:包括系统设置、通知管理、电源管理等,为用户提供便捷的服务。
安卓系统构架就像一幅七彩的人生画卷,每一层都充满了色彩:
1. 应用层:五彩斑斓,充满了各种应用程序,满足用户的各种需求。
2. 应用框架层:色彩斑斓,提供了丰富的API和组件,让开发者可以轻松地开发出各种应用程序。
3. 系统运行库层:色彩斑斓,为应用程序提供了强大的支持。
4. Linux内核层:色彩斑斓,为整个系统提供了稳定的运行环境。
5. Android运行时:色彩斑斓,为应用程序的运行提供了高效的保障。
6. 应用程序框架:色彩斑斓,为开发者提供了丰富的开发资源。
7. 系统工具和服务:色彩斑斓,为用户提供便捷的服务。
随着科技的不断发展,安卓系统构架也在不断地进化。未来,我们可以期待:
1. 更高效的应用程序运行:随着硬件和软件的不断优化,应用程序的运行将会更加高效。
2. 更丰富的应用程序生态:随着开发者的不断加入,安卓系统将会拥有更加丰富的应用程序生态。
3. 更智能的系统服务:随着人工智能技术的发展,安卓系统将会提供更加智能的系统服务。
4. 更安全的系统环境:随着安全技术的不断进步,安卓系统将会提供更加安全的系统环境。
安卓系统构架就像一个神奇的乐高积木,每一块都紧密相连,共同构建了一个丰富多彩的世界。让我们一起期待,这个世界的未来将会更加美好!